The day-to-day responsibilities of a Print Production Associate are diverse, focusing on the entire lifecycle of a print job within a production facility. Common duties include operating and maintaining digital and sometimes offset printing presses, large-format printers, and bindery equipment such as cutters, folders, and staplers. A significant portion of the role involves rigorous quality control, meticulously inspecting prints for color accuracy, registration, and any defects to ensure every piece meets strict standards. Associates also handle the logistical flow of materials, managing paper and substrate inventory, preparing files for print, and conducting post-production finishing work like trimming, laminating, or assembling. Maintaining a clean, safe, and organized workspace is a fundamental aspect of the job, adhering to all operational and safety protocols. To excel in Print Production Associate jobs, candidates typically possess a blend of technical aptitude and soft skills. While formal education requirements often start with a high school diploma or equivalent, on-the-job training is common. Employers generally seek individuals with a foundational understanding of print processes, basic mechanics, and color theory. Proficiency with computers is essential for navigating print management software and digital file preparation. The most critical attributes are a keen eye for detail, manual dexterity, and a methodical approach to tasks. Strong time-management and organizational skills are necessary to handle multiple jobs simultaneously and meet tight deadlines. The ability to follow complex instructions precisely, solve minor technical issues, and work effectively both independently and as part of a collaborative team is paramount. Physical stamina is also important, as the role may involve standing for extended periods, lifting materials, and handling repetitive motions.
